  • 2008-5-18Tongji medical rescue team arrives in the hardest-hit area--Mianzhu City smoothly with the help of Secretary-General Fan Keqin of Guangxi Chamber of Commerce in Sichuan as well as Wu Yanxiang, secretary of Party Committee of Sichuan Investment-Inviting Bureau. At present, the team has settled down in a temporary medical aid site in the stadium set up by Mianzhu Government. Together with experts from the 44th Chengdu Military Hospital, Tongji rescue team assists the People’s Hospital of Mianzhu with medical relief work. In order to avoid the epidemic, all towns and townships with serious housing collapse have been strictly blockaded, and most of the wounded in Mianzhu City were taken to this medical relief point after the sixth day of earthquake. However, rescue teams could only handle simple debridement without carrying out surgery temporarily because the current water-electricity supply was not normal. It’s expected to resume power supply tomorrow basically. (Lin Hua)
